Peru’s first Iron Mineral Sands
Project
Magnetite with a low Titanium content has been confirmed as the dominant magnetic mineral.
Conceptual exploration target of 2 Billion tones of mineralized sediments *
Gold grades of potential economic significance have been encountered.
Discrete liberated mineral grains of recoverable size of Zircon, Ilmenite , and Andalusite have been identified.
*On 9 and 10 May 2011 Latin announced a conceptual exploration target of 2 billion tons of mineralised sediment at
Guadalupito (within a range 2.0-2.6 billion tones). This conceptual exploration target was based on an estimated area of 6000
hectares of prospective sediments generated from detailed field mapping, a mineralised depth of 20 m as suggested by initial
test drilling and an estimated S.G. of 1.8-2.2. Work conducted at Guadalupito to date highlights good potential for economic
content of: Magnetite (3.5% - 15.1%) ,Andalusite (5.3% – 16.5%) ,Gold (6 - 556 mg/m3) and potentially economic content of:
Monazite (REE) (trace – 1.7%) ,Zircon (trace – 1.1%) ,Ilmenite (trace – 2.8%) ,Wolframite (trace). The potential quantity and
grade is conceptual in nature, and there has been insufficient exploration to define a Mineral Resource and it is uncertain if
further exploration will result in the determination of a Mineral Resource.

Initial JORC Inferred Resource
Above water table JORC Inferred Resource – 38MT @8.9% Heavy Mineral
Below water table JORC Inferred Resource – 81MT@ 4.1% Heavy Mineral
Total JORC Inferred Resource of 119MT @ 5.7% Heavy Mineral
Initial JORC carried out over 682 ha
–Total Concession Hectares 16,437
68 Sonic Holes completed – Total drill program of 1500 holes

Drill results Ilo Norte
Iron and copper mineralisation in all 8 initial exploratory holes 120m from 24m @ 0.13% Cu, 20.38% Fe in hole IN-02
Gold anomalism coincident with Copper mineralisation 14m from 52m @ 0.55% Cu, 0.13g/t Au in hole IN-02 and
22m from 254m @ 0.25% Cu, 0.09g/t Au in hole IN-03
Anomalous Zinc values
Mineralized unit more than 250m thick
Infill drilling planned 1st Half 2012
